    Delta Airlines employs approximately 91,000 people as of 2023. This workforce supports its extensive flight operations and customer service initiatives across the globe.

    Delta Airlines Employee Statistics 2023

    As of 2023, Delta Airlines has around 91,000 employees. This number has fluctuated over the years due to various factors such as economic conditions, travel demand, and operational needs. The airline has made efforts to hire more staff in response to increasing travel demand post-pandemic.

    Year Employee Count
    2020 75,000
    2021 80,000
    2022 87,000
    2023 91,000
